Output e694858be68d79e0a60347ba9a24d3a9a57d197f96613db1b81d8cb0c5f40a2e:1

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24dafee0b59ab147b8c17c592cd15336904dc8c9 OP_EQUAL
address
353tbXoK4QTwqBAFikRXxJd29ZYurp2X53
transaction
e694858be68d79e0a60347ba9a24d3a9a57d197f96613db1b81d8cb0c5f40a2e
spent
true